Flying low level is almost as good as our session pale… the only question is are you rotary or fixed wing?
Low Level is brewed without compromise. Deceivingly thick and full bodied, with both hot and cold side additions of Mosaic and Citra. Balanced, fruity and perfectly sessionable.

Can from the brewery online shop. Pours hazy golden orange with a thin white head. Aromas of pineapple and peach, light malt. Taste adds light grapefruit. Thin finish.

Can. Just a mild haze on this gold beer, small bubbly pale cream colour head, doesn't last long. Palate is light with modest fine minerally carbonation. Thin malts, some grain here, could pass for a cask lager in some ways. Decent piney hops and modest and fairly ripe citrus. A little brighter orange on the minerally crisp finish. Not bad, just a bit thin. .
